Unfortunately, they are not in order. For example to create a rotator in C++ the constructor is: FRotator ( float InPitch, float InYaw, float InRoll )
It’s really confusing to me that UE mixes x,y,z rotations with pitch, yaw, and roll rotations. If I make a rotator in C++ for example I have to give the angles in order pitch, yaw and roll. However, in the blueprint class editor, rotations are in x, y, and z. So pitch, yaw and rolls would be y, z, and x… Not only different names, but also a different order. Besides the names and the order, is there any other differences between these two systems? If not, what is the advantage of using both systems in one engine? It seems so pointlessly confusing…
